Nicholas Burgess --new kid come to town-- finds an ally in Lorelai Vaughn, the girl whose life is forever changed by a gruesome freak accident and the events that follow it. Sparks fly, and love is in the air... Until baggage from Nick's' past comes blowing through town in the form of a jilted best friend, and Lorelai finds that old family secrets don't stay hidden just because we will them to. There are people that you meet that have the power to change your life. Sometimes we fight for them, sometimes we lie for them, sometimes we even fall in love with them. And sometimes, we do all three. Haunted by their own respective traumas, Lorelai and Nick learn that while suffering may not be beautiful, survival is.
